AcreTrader Releases Research on California Wine Grape Market

Farmland Investment Platform Reports on Trends Currently Impacting California’s Wine Industry and Land Values in Key Grape-Growing Regions


Fayetteville, Ark., May 25,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- AcreTrader, the land investment platform at the intersection of agriculture, tech and finance, recently released “Themes in the California Wine Industry: Exploring Paso Robles AVA,” an analysis of supply and demand dynamics in today’s wine market. The report examines market shifts in order to provide farmland investors insight into factors affecting land values of California’s wine grape-bearing acreage, especially within the rapidly growing Paso Robles American Viticultural Area (AVA). 
California wine grape markets have been marked in recent years by ongoing premiumization in consumer tastes. Known for its red wine varietal cabernet sauvignon, Paso Robles is well-positioned to meet demand for premium wines. As Paso Robles wines have grown increasingly popular, the wine region has received coverage in leading industry publications such as Wine Enthusiast and Bloomberg, underlined by high-profile property acquisitions by major wineries like Duckhorn and E&J Gallo.
AcreTrader’s research examines these factors in-depth and looks at potential impacts of water scarcity on vineyard acreage and land values.
